Joomla Extensions: A Complete Overview
When it pertains to constructing a powerful site, one of the most essential functions a CMS can use is the capability to expand its functionality. Joomla sticks out in this field by supplying an extremely versatile expansion system that allows individuals to include a wide range of functions to their web sites. Whether you're producing a blog, an e-commerce website, or a company website, Joomla's extensions are crucial to opening the complete capacity of your site.
Joomla extensions come in several kinds, varying from straightforward components to complicated components. In this full overview, we'll dive deep right into the different sorts of Joomla expansions, just how they work, and just how to discover and mount them.
What Are Joomla Extensions?
In Joomla, an expansion is a piece of software that includes new functionality to the core CMS. These expansions can assist you manage web content, improve layout, optimize search engine optimization, and integrate with third-party services. Expansions in Joomla are classified right into four main types:
Parts
Components are the largest and most complex sorts of Joomla expansions. They control the material presented on the front-end of your site and are often the major useful aspects of your website. As an example, a blog, a shopping cart, or a forum are all applied with parts. Elements typically consist of both front-end and back-end interfaces and are capable of dealing with complex tasks.
Components
Modules are smaller blocks of material or capability that show up around the major component content. They can be shown in various settings throughout the web site, such as sidebars, footers, or headers. Instances of modules include a login type, a search box, or a social networks sharing plugin. Components don't have their very own data source or facility back-end user interfaces, but they communicate with the element they come from.
Plugins
Plugins are light-weight expansions that include little functionality to your Joomla website. They are generally caused by particular events, such as filling a web page, sending a kind, or clicking a switch. Plugins can expand the performance of elements, modules, or perhaps Joomla's core system. For example, a plugin might enhance your site's pictures, implement a web content slider, or handle search engine optimization metadata automatically.
Themes
Layouts are in charge of the visual discussion of your Joomla site. They regulate the design, layout, and appearance of your material, making your internet site aesthetically appealing. Joomla layouts can be highly customizable and be available in both complimentary and paid variations. A layout usually includes a set of predefined settings where modules and elements can be shown.
Why Use Joomla Extensions?
Joomla's extensions system enables you to improve your website's functionality and tailor it to satisfy particular organization or personal needs. Right here are some vital reasons you ought to take into consideration utilizing Joomla extensions:
Personalization and Flexibility
Joomla's considerable library of extensions provides you the power to build a website precisely the method you want it. Whether you require advanced search engine optimization devices, a full-fledged e-commerce store, or a basic get in touch with type, there is an extension offered to suit your requirements. The ability to install and manage these extensions without coding expertise makes Joomla one of the most adaptable CMS platforms available.
Conserve Effort And Time
By using pre-built Joomla expansions, you can save on your own the hassle of establishing intricate functionality from square one. Instead of creating customized code for attributes like here social networks sharing, settlement portals, or multilingual content, you can just install the pertinent expansion and configure it according to your needs. This can considerably minimize advancement time and price.
Increase Functionality
Joomla's extension collection is regularly increasing, supplying a wide range of functionalities that can improve your web site. Whether you require devices for material administration, safety and security, SEO, or efficiency optimization, Joomla's expansions can offer the included capability that aids your internet site attract attention from the group.
Community and Support
Joomla has an active area of designers and users that add expansions and supply assistance. This implies that you can quickly locate remedies to issues or concerns with expansions, as well as discover just how to take advantage of the devices available. With an energetic online forum, user overviews, and an expanding database of extensions, Joomla guarantees you have accessibility to useful resources.
Exactly How to Locate Joomla Expansions
Discovering the right extension for your internet site is crucial to ensuring that it satisfies your demands. Joomla offers an extensive platform for finding and downloading and install extensions:
Joomla Extensions Directory (JED).
The Joomla Extensions Directory site is the primary source for locating Joomla extensions. The JED is home to countless expansions, categorized by type (components, modules, plugins, layouts, and so on) and function (e-commerce, SEO, protection, and so on). You can easily search for extensions based on key phrases or check out the groups to locate the devices that suit your needs.
Third-Party Internet site.
While the JED is the best resource for most Joomla expansions, there are additionally several third-party internet sites that offer premium extensions, some of which may not be detailed in the main Joomla directory. Popular websites include JoomlaShack, JoomlArt, and RocketTheme, which supply both cost-free and exceptional expansions and design templates.
Joomla Extension Reviews and Recommendations.
Prior to mounting an expansion, it is very important to review testimonials from other users to make sure that it is dependable and well-kept. The JED allows users to rate expansions and leave responses, assisting you select the very best expansions for your website. Furthermore, Joomla-related blog sites and forums usually include recommendations and thorough testimonials of prominent extensions.
Exactly How to Mount Joomla Extensions.
Setting up expansions in Joomla is a basic procedure. Below's how you can do it:.
Download the Expansion.
Go to the Joomla Extensions Directory or an additional trusted web site to download the extension plan. Expansions commonly come as a.zip documents.
Set Up by means of Joomla Admin Panel.
Visit to your Joomla admin panel. Navigate to "Extensions" and afterwards "Manage." Click "Install" to upload the extension file. Joomla will immediately install the extension and inform you if it achieved success.
Set up the Extension.
After setup, you can configure the extension by browsing to the "Parts" or "Modules" area in the Joomla admin panel. Many extensions have their own configuration food selections that allow you to tailor their setups to fit your requirements.
Popular Joomla Expansions to Think About.
Below are several of one of the most prominent and beneficial Joomla extensions to consider for your internet site:.
Akeeba Backup: A reliable back-up service for Joomla websites.
VirtueMart: An effective shopping service that transforms your Joomla internet site right into an on the internet shop.
K2: A prominent content administration extension for Joomla that enhances short article monitoring.
JCE Editor: A feature-rich material editor that offers more modification and control over content production.
Sh404SEF: A SEO extension that helps with URL optimization, metadata, and much more.
Joomla search engine optimization: A straightforward yet effective device to handle search engine optimization setups on your Joomla site.